Microsoft Money: Microsoft Money is a personal finance management software that was discontinued in 2009. It helped users organize finances, track spending, create budgets, manage investments, and pay bills online.

PetrolSpy: PetrolSpy is a gas price comparison app for iOS and Android. It allows drivers to find the lowest nearby gas prices based on data crowdsourced from users. The app has a minimalist UI with features like price graphs, custom price alerts, and integration with mapping apps.
